Aaron: textfeld[] überprüfen

Hi,

es geht um einen Anmeldevorgang für ein Event... ich habe 3 Seiten die mit PHP gesteuert werden... Formulareingaben sollen mit JavaScript auf Gültigkeit untersucht werden.

Seite1:
User wählt u.a. aus wieviele Personen er anmelden möchte

Seite2:
Es erscheint für jede anzumeldende Person ein Textfeld mit <input type=text name="name[]">

Seite3:
Alle eingaben werden mit PHP in Datenbank eingetragen, Mail verschickt usw. Dabei wird eine Schleife sooft durchlaufen wie Elemente das Array "name" hat (sizeof-funktion).

Nun mein Problem: Wie überprüfe ich per JS die dynamische Zahl an Textfeldern auf Eingabe (d.h. ist leer oder nicht). Oder: Wie kann ich per JS auf ein spezielles Textfeld zugreifen. Ich hab ein bisschen probiert... scheinbar numeriert JS nicht einfach durch wie ich es erwartet habe (name[0], name[1], usw.). Oder doch???

Vielleicht weiss jemand eine Antwort! Dankeschön!

Aaron

  1. Hallo,

    Nun mein Problem: Wie überprüfe ich per JS die dynamische Zahl an Textfeldern auf Eingabe (d.h. ist leer oder nicht). Oder: Wie kann ich per JS auf ein spezielles Textfeld zugreifen. Ich hab ein bisschen probiert... scheinbar numeriert JS nicht einfach durch wie ich es erwartet habe (name[0], name[1], usw.). Oder doch???

    document.formularname.elements["name[]"][0 bis document.formularname.elements["name[]"].length-1]...

    MfG, Thomas

  2. hi Aaron

    mal eine grundsatzfrage:

    wenn du eh schon eine serverseitige programmiersprache (php) zur verfügung hast, warum willst du dann auf sowas unzuverlässiges* wie javascript zurückgreifen?

    so long
    ole
    (8-)>

    *in dem sinne das man es einfach ausschalten kann